A Smart TV’s App Store functions as a digital marketplace where users can peruse, download, and install TV-specific apps. Like the Samsung Smart Hub, LG Content Store, or Roku Channel Store, each Smart TV brand usually has its own app store.

These platforms curate a variety of applications that address a range of interests, such as fitness, education, entertainment, & more. Users can tailor their Smart TV experience to their tastes thanks to the variety of applications that are available. It can be thrilling to browse the app store because it offers a plethora of opportunities. In addition to exploring popular apps and discovering new content, users can also locate specialized products that suit their interests. With categories like “Top Free,” “Top Paid,” and “New Releases,” the app stores frequently make it simpler for users to locate well-liked or recently released apps.

Also, a lot of app stores offer ratings and reviews from users, which can help prospective downloaders choose which apps to install. You must connect your Smart TV to the internet before you can explore the available apps in the app store. Wi-Fi and Ethernet connections are two of the many internet connectivity options available on the majority of Smart TVs. If you would rather have a wireless setup, you can choose your home network & input the password by going to the Wi-Fi settings on your TV. Usually, this procedure is simple & directed by on-screen instructions.

The most dependable option for users who choose a wired connection is frequently to connect an Ethernet cable straight from your router to the TV. This method can offer a more reliable internet connection, which is especially helpful for uninterrupted high-definition video streaming. After connecting, your Smart TV will typically run a brief network test to make sure it’s working properly. Now that you have internet access, you can browse the enormous selection of apps in the app store on your Smart TV.

The process of downloading and installing an app on your Smart TV is usually simple once you’ve found one that interests you. Once you’ve chosen the desired app from the app store, “Download” or “Install” will typically be an option.

This button starts the download process, which could take a few seconds to several minutes, depending on your internet speed and the size of the app. The installation process typically starts on its own after the download is finished. After installation, the app usually shows up in your app library or on your home screen for convenient access.

Before you can use certain Smart TVs, you might need to log in or register for an account. For streaming services that need user authentication to access content libraries, this step is typical. You can now take advantage of the features and content of the app after it has been successfully installed and set up. In order to guarantee optimal performance and access to new features or content, it is imperative that you keep your apps updated. The majority of Smart TVs come with automatic update settings that let apps update on their own without the need for user input. If users would rather have more control over this procedure, they can manually check for updates.

To manually update an app, go to your Smart TV’s settings menu or app store. There should be an option labeled “Updates” or “Manage Apps,” where you can see which applications have available updates. When you choose an app, you usually get the option to update it right away. Frequent app updates improve functionality and guarantee that any bugs or security flaws are fixed quickly.

Even though downloading apps on a Smart TV usually goes smoothly, users may occasionally run into problems that make downloads or installations unsuccessful. Common problems include slow internet connections, insufficient storage space on the device, or compatibility issues with certain applications. To effectively address these problems, the underlying cause must be found. Check your internet connection first by doing a speed test or trying to stream content from another app if you encounter slow download speeds or unsuccessful installations.

Try restarting your router or, if you’re using Wi-Fi, moving closer to it if connectivity problems continue. Also, make sure your Smart TV has adequate storage space; if not, removing unnecessary apps could make room for new downloads. When compatibility problems occur, like when you try to download an app that isn’t compatible with your particular model, visiting the manufacturer’s website or contacting customer service can help you understand your options. FAQs

What types of Smart TVs allow app downloads?

Most Smart TVs from major brands like Samsung, LG, Sony, and Vizio support app downloads through their respective app stores. The availability depends on the TV’s operating system and model.

Do I need an internet connection to download apps on a Smart TV?

Yes, a stable internet connection is required to access the app store and download apps onto your Smart TV.

How do I access the app store on my Smart TV?

You can usually access the app store by pressing the dedicated “Apps” or “Smart Hub” button on your TV remote, or by navigating through the TV’s main menu.

Are all apps free to download on Smart TVs?

Not all apps are free. While many apps are free to download, some may require a purchase or subscription to access their content.

Can I download apps that are not available in my region?

App availability varies by region due to licensing restrictions. Some apps may not be accessible if they are not supported in your country.

Is it possible to update apps on a Smart TV?

Yes, most Smart TVs allow you to update installed apps through the app store or system settings to ensure you have the latest features and security patches.

What should I do if an app is not working after download?

Try restarting your Smart TV, checking for app or system updates, or reinstalling the app. If problems persist, consult the TV manufacturer’s support resources.

Can I download apps on older Smart TV models?

Older Smart TV models may have limited app support or may not support new apps. Check your TV’s specifications and app store availability to confirm.

Do I need to create an account to download apps on my Smart TV?

Many Smart TV platforms require you to sign in with an account (such as Samsung, LG, or Google accounts) to download and manage apps.

Can I use external devices to access apps if my Smart TV does not support them?

Yes, you can use external streaming devices like Roku, Amazon Fire Stick, or Chromecast to access a wider range of apps on your TV.
